Random House presents the audiobook edition of Self Care for the Real World: Practical Self Care Advice for Everyday Life, written and read by Nadia Narain and Katia Narain Phillips.

THE TOP TEN BESTSELLER

'Unusually practical, non-patronising and authentic. Think Marie Kondo for the mind' Sunday Times
Wellness pioneers Nadia Narain and Katia Narain Phillips have spent decades helping others to feel their best. But it took them a bit longer to learn to care for themselves. Here they share the small, achievable steps they picked up on a lifetime's journey towards self-care, and how you can apply them to your life, wherever you are.
Right now, you may be deep in the waves of life, being tossed around. Learning self-care is like building your own life boat, plank by plank. Once you've got your boat, you'll still be rocked by the same waves, but you'll have a feeling of safety, and a stability that means you can pick other people up on your way.

      Coauthors, sisters, and wellness gurus Nadia and Katia are equally ardent in their alternating narrations of this practical guide on self-care. Together, they work to convince listeners of the importance of self-respect, self-compassion, and taking care of our own needs in order to be kinder, more giving people who can impact others more positively. The sisters' amiable tone mirrors their straightforward advice and doable tips on how to cope with personal hardships such as breakups, grief, and loneliness, as well as day-to-day scheduling like meal prep and managing social media. This is an invaluable treasure trove of ideas on becoming the best version of ourselves. M.F. © AudioFile 2019, Portland, Maine
